EFB Journal New Biotechnology

Jasmonates are signals in the biosynthesis of secondary metabolites — Pathways, transcription factors and applied aspects — A brief review

This brief review describes modes of action of Jasmonates in the biosynthesis of nicotine, glucosinolates, anthocyanins, terpenoid indole alkaloids.

ESACT meeting Banner

Cell culture technologies: bridging academia and industry to provide solutions for patients

We are providing an exciting setting for around 1100 participants from industry and academia which will facilitate the outstanding networking and exchange of ideas that the ESACT meetings are so famous for. The meeting will feature excellent scientific presentations, including key notes by Prof. Mathias Uhlen and Prof. Peter Zandstra, engaging and interactive poster sessions, and a social programme designed to promote interactions and networking. The program will take you through the streets, canals and gardens of Copenhagen, and expose you to sessions spanning a range of topics such as new therapeutic products and vaccines, cell engineering, cell-based technologies and therapeutics, process control and engineering, and new downstream technologies.
